Comparing IGCSE Boards

 Cambridge IGCSE


Developed by the University of Cambridge International Examinations (CIE).

Known for its rigorous assessment and high academic standards.

Offers a broad range of subjects, allowing students to select their preferred subjects.

Exams are conducted in May/June and October/November series each year.

Assessments include written exams, practical assessments, and coursework, depending on the subject.

 Edexcel IGCSE


Offered by Pearson Edexcel, a part of Pearson Education Ltd.

It places emphasis on both theoretical knowledge and practical application.

  • Provides a comprehensive range of subjects catering to diverse interests.

The main exam series takes place in January and May/June each year.

Assessment methods involve written papers, oral examinations, and practical assessments.


 OxfordAQA IGCSE


Developed through a collaboration between Oxford University Press and AQA (Assessment and Qualifications Alliance).

  • It balances academic excellence with skill development.
  • It offers a wide selection of subjects designed to foster critical thinking.
  • Exams typically take place in May/June and November series annually.
  • Evaluation methods include written papers, practical examinations, and coursework.


    IGCSE Curriculum and Syllabus


While all three boards follow the IGCSE curriculum, variations exist in syllabi and subject content.

Cambridge IGCSE tends to be more traditional and academically focused.

Edexcel IGCSE often incorporates practical elements to enhance learning.

OxfordAQA IGCSE emphasizes critical thinking and problem-solving skills.


IGCSE Examination Assessment


Cambridge IGCSE employs a grade system from A* to G, with A* being the highest grade.

Edexcel IGCSE follows a numerical grading format, from 9 (highest) to 1 (lowest).

OxfordAQA IGCSE utilizes a numerical scale from 9 to 1, similar to the Edexcel system.



IGCSE Exam Structure


Cambridge IGCSE and OxfordAQA IGCSE typically have a linear structure, with all exams taken at the end of the course.

Edexcel IGCSE often adopts a modular approach, allowing students to take exams in different stages throughout the course.


IGCSE Recognition and Acceptance


All three boards are widely recognized and accepted by universities, colleges, and employers globally.

Students can use these qualifications to pursue higher education or employment opportunities internationally.


IGCSE Exam Conduct and Support


Cambridge IGCSE, Edexcel, and OxfordAQA IGCSE exams are conducted at authorized exam centers worldwide.

Each board provides comprehensive resources, study materials, and support for teachers and students preparing for the exams.
